sice i "support" all windows nt/9x OS's now, waveout ("safe") is default (too lazy to write autodetection).
yes, directsound output is more integrated with fb2k, and needs less resources to operate (also waveout is always stutter-happy on my machine no matter what because it doesn't use hardware mixing); it's recommended that you use directsound on win2k/xp.
